Product reviews:
Super Colossal Tyrannosaurus Rex super colossal t rex walmart
super colossal t rex walmart
Giles
2025-10-21 iphone 6s Plus
Super Colossal Tyrannosaurus Rex super colossal t rex walmart
super colossal t rex walmart
Super Colossal Tyrannosaurus Rex super colossal t rex walmart
super colossal t rex walmart